olaf neophyte and de.po updates, valgrind tweaks, delete green lady, inkscape dpi=96
[goodguy/history.git] / cinelerra-5.1 / cinelerra / file.inc
index ecc7a2b9c9ae4244a7614daa2998c2f70cfeeed2..8bcda4ebe6a454441b3f22829b8f725bedc0d190 100644 (file)
 #ifndef FILE_INC
 #define FILE_INC
 
+// Normally, these are sourced from the compiler command line
+//   as: c++ -Dvar=value defines
+#ifndef CIN_CONFIG
+#define CIN_CONFIG "~/.bcast5"
+#endif
+#ifndef LOCALE_DIR
+#define LOCALE_DIR "$CIN_LIB/locale"
+#endif
+#ifndef CINDAT_DIR
+#define CINDAT_DIR "$CIN_PATH"
+#endif
+#ifndef CINLIB_DIR
+#define CINLIB_DIR "$CIN_PATH"
+#endif
+#ifndef PLUGIN_DIR
+#define PLUGIN_DIR "$CIN_LIB/plugins"
+#endif
+#ifndef LADSPA_DIR
+#define LADSPA_DIR "$CIN_LIB/ladspa"
+#endif
+#ifndef CIN_BROWSER
+#define CIN_BROWSER "firefox"
+#endif
+
 #include "language.h"
 
 // Return values for open_file
@@ -65,6 +89,8 @@
 #define FILE_CR2_LIST           35
 #define FILE_GIF_LIST          36
 #define FILE_DB                 37
+#define FILE_PPM                38
+#define FILE_PPM_LIST           39
 
 // For formats supported by plugins, the format number is the plugin number in the
 // plugin list ORed with 0x8000.
@@ -90,6 +116,8 @@ N_("OGG Theora/Vorbis")
 N_("OGG Vorbis")    // For decoding only
 N_("PNG")
 N_("PNG Sequence")
+N_("PPM")
+N_("PPM Sequence")
 N_("Raw DV")
 N_("Raw PCM")
 N_("Sun/NeXT AU")
@@ -122,6 +150,8 @@ N_("Unknown sound")
 #define PCM_NAME               "Raw PCM"
 #define PNG_LIST_NAME          "PNG Sequence"
 #define PNG_NAME               "PNG"
+#define PPM_LIST_NAME          "PPM Sequence"
+#define PPM_NAME               "PPM"
 #define RAWDV_NAME             "Raw DV"
 #define SCENE_NAME             "Text To Movie"
 #define SND_NAME               "Unknown sound"